Frenzal Rhomb is an Australian punk rock band formed in 1992 that continues to tour and release new music. Known for their provocative nature, the band has sparked controversy for album covers, song titles, lyrical content, on-stage and off-stage behavior, as well as their association with causes such as veganism and politics. Guitarist Lindsay McDougall was responsible for Rock Against Howard, a compilation of Australian musicians against John Howard's government. Some of their most representative songs include 'My Name Is', 'The Ballad of the Broken Hearted', 'You're Not My Friend', and 'The Great Australian Dream'.
